GuidePoint Security is seeking a 100% remote Okta Engineer to help support client projects and serve as the subject matter expert, responsible for architecting, designing and implementing a variety of identity and access management solutions. Duties will consist of scoping and leading projects for the installation, configuration, upgrade, and patching of Identity and Access Management products, including Okta, SailPoint, and others, as well as supporting technologies. The candidate will also participate in general maintenance and support activities such as performance monitoring/tuning and troubleshooting of issues that arise in IAM environments. Additional project duties include gathering, defining and refining of client requirements, solution design, creation of technical documentation, and development of customized security components

Role and Responsibilities:

• Participate in discussions on IAM architecture, process, and governance development
• Develop deployment and implementation methodology and standards consistent with vendor best practices
• Install, integrate, configure, deploy and architect IAM solutions and systems to facilitate User Life-Cycle Management, Identity and Access Governance, Automated Provisioning, Single Sign-On, Federation, Privileged Account Management.
• Transcribe and present technical information to business / executive levels
• Develop and execute test cases and test plans for IAM solutions
• Work directly with clients to develop and refine requirements for new installs, upgrades, re-implementations, and feature enhancements
• Lead the analysis and design of IAM solutions featuring Okta and related technologies
• Prioritize and execute on tasks required for solution delivery on new installations, upgrades, feature enhancements, re-implementations, and at-risk projects
• Understand and explain the concepts central to IAM and relevant to enterprise implementations including identity, identity lifecycle, identity governance, access, authorization, directory, and entitlements.
• Work directly with clients and sales engineers to scope and level projects, perform functional analysis, identify assumptions, and assist in the creation of proposals
• Assist in the design and production of technical documentation, including product deployment and configuration documents
• Provide advanced troubleshooting support for enterprise clients
